K-Beauty Philosophy 🤔

Korean skincare focuses on prevention rather than correction. Instead of fixing problems later, it aims to maintain healthy skin from the beginning through hydration and protection.

From my experience, I used to rely on strong treatments to fix issues quickly. However, my skin improved only when I focused on gentle, consistent care. This mindset shift made a huge difference.

💡 Tip: Focus on prevention and long-term skin health.

Korean Skincare Routine 📊

The famous Korean skincare routine is about layering lightweight products to build hydration gradually. It does not have to be 10 steps; even a simplified version can be effective.

Personally, I adopted a 5-step routine: cleanser, toner, essence, serum, and moisturizer. In the morning, I added sunscreen. This layering approach made my skin more hydrated and radiant.

Routine Structure

Step Product Purpose Note
1 Cleanser Remove impurities Double cleanse if needed
2 Toner Hydration Layer lightly
3 Essence Skin repair Core step
4 Serum Target concerns Customize
5 Moisturizer Seal hydration Essential

Key K-Beauty Ingredients 🔬

Korean skincare uses unique ingredients known for their soothing and hydrating properties. These ingredients focus on strengthening the skin barrier and improving overall health.

From my experience, using products with snail mucin improved hydration and skin texture. Centella asiatica helped calm irritation, while niacinamide improved skin tone.

Popular ingredients include snail mucin, centella asiatica, niacinamide, green tea extract, and hyaluronic acid.

Common Mistakes 🚫

Many people misunderstand Korean skincare. Using too many products or copying routines without understanding your skin type can lead to irritation.

In my case, I tried to follow a full 10-step routine immediately, which overwhelmed my skin. Simplifying the routine made it much more effective.

Avoid over-layering, using unsuitable products, ignoring your skin type, and skipping sunscreen.

FAQ

Q1. Do I need a 10-step routine?
No, even a simplified routine can be effective if done consistently.

Q2. What is the most important step?
Hydration and sun protection are the most important steps.

Q3. Are Korean products better?
They focus on hydration and gentle care, which works well for many skin types.

Q4. How long does it take to see results?
Most people see noticeable improvements within 2–4 weeks.

Q5. Can all skin types follow K-beauty?
Yes, but routines should be adjusted based on individual skin needs.
